I do not know about that card, but a NAK means negative acknowledge. The i2c bus is a two wire bus with a clock line and a data line. When the bus controller addresses a chip on the bus, the controller sends that chip an address, a register number, and an indication whether it is going to be reading or writing that register; then it performs an acknowledge. During the acknowledge, the controller lets go of the data line (stops driving it) and 'listens' to the bus. If there is a chip on the bus at the address that was sent, and if that chip is capable of performing the specified read or write operation on the specified register, the chip will take control of the data line and will hold it low. If it does not (negative acknowledge) the data line "floats" high. If the controller sees the line go high during the ack cycle, it knows either there is no chip at that address, or the chip is refusing the command. Once the controller determines the ACK/NAK, it ends the acknowledge cycle by pulling the clock low at which point the target chip will release the data bus.
So, either the driver seems to be trying to write a 0x00 to register 0x0d of a chip called cx22702. Any chance that Hauppauge changes chips from version to version?
